LARRY CHARLES STROUP, age 81, of Bloomingburg, passed away peacefully on Monday, February 16, 2026 at his home.
He was born on February 15, 1945 in Dayton, Ohio to the late Charles P. and Mary E. (Nevil) Stroup. He was a graduate of Miami Trace High School. Larry retired from truck driving. He enjoyed mowing his lawn, gardening, collecting cars, spending time with his family, and his family said, “He never knew a stranger!”
In addition to his parents, Larry was preceded in death by his children, Kimberly Stroup, Rocky Stroup, Jr., and Cody Stroup; granddaughter, Rachel McGraw; and great-grandson, Miller McGraw.
Survivors include his loving and devoted wife, Mary Eileen (Runnels) Stroup, whom he married on February 23, 1985; his children, Lorry Stroup, and Jason Hawkins; grandchildren, Mark Rittenhouse, Matthew Stroup, Megan Stroup, Autumn Hawkins, and Peyton Hawkins; several great-grandchildren; and siblings, Barbara Wood, Ronald (Vivian) Stroup, Linder Stroup, and Mary (Chris) Miller. Also surviving are several nieces and nephews along with a host of friends.
The family would like to extend a special thanks to the staff of Heartland Hospice for the excellent care they provided while Larry was in his final days.
The funeral service will be held on Thursday, February 19, 2026 at 3:00 p.m. at the Summers Funeral Home with Sandy Parrish officiating. Family and friends may visit at the funeral home on Thursday afternoon from 1:00 p.m. until the time of service. In keeping with his wishes, cremation is to follow.
